暂时未有相关云产品技术能力~
简介: CSDN优秀作者、华为云专家 领域: Java框架、并发编程、分布式、微服务、Redis、HarmonyOS、中间件等技术
Unsafe-Java永远的“神”(二)
Unsafe-Java永远的“神”(一)
最基础的ASCII、Unicode、UTF-8一起来多了解点
MySQL新增字段报错:ERROR 1118 -- Row size too large. The maximum row size for the used table type
xshell 所选的用户密钥未在远程主机上注册
VMware克隆虚拟机后修改MAC地址、UUID、IP和主机名
nginx限流
Lua+OpenResty+nginx+redis+canal实现缓存策略
解决 openresty Nginx 重启报错问题 nginx: [error] open() “/usr/local/openresty/nginx/logs/nginx.pid“ fa
金蝶BOS开发代码调用过程
金蝶EAS-BOS编码规则
金蝶BOS开发属性中规则事件
大学毕业年的找工作和学习总结
java 5 个常用的api包
MYSQL 中 LIMIT 用法
JDK1.9 新特性(最全)
HashMap中实现原理及hashcode方法
interrupted()和isInterrupted()
如何让 a == 1 && a == 2 && a == 3同时成立?
for(;;)和while(true)的区别
this与super
Java之IO_NIO五种模型介绍
Unsafe使用示例代码(二)
Unsafe使用示例代码(一)
死锁
ThreadLocal
MySQL之group by
MySQL之函数
MySQL中组合字段之concat()
MySQL中使用正则表达式
like操作符
MySQL操作符(and、or、in、not)
where使用
order by使用
select、distinct、limit使用
如何查看MySQL数据库状态及信息(内存、数据库、编码格式、表、列、索引等)
MySQL数据库入门
解决 openresty Nginx 重启报错问题 nginx: [error] open() “/usr/local/openresty/nginx/logs/nginx.pid“ fa
金蝶BOS开发代码调用过程
金蝶EAS-BOS编码规则
HashMap详解
Java访问修饰符的正确使用姿势
枚举代替常量
如何正确的重写hashcode()
equals方法通用约定
在Java开发中,程序员经常会遇到各种资源的释放问题。比如最常见的I/O操作,我们往往会通过调用API提供的close方法来关闭流,释放资源。但是追求极致的程序员会发现,这种方式存在不少问题,比如忘记关闭流、代码不美观、异常不好处理等等。
在Java开发中,程序员要尽可能的避免创建相同的功能的对象,因为这样既消耗内存,又影响程序运行速度。在这种情况下可以考虑重复利用对象。
我们Java程序员编码时谈论的最多的两个字就是对象,Java中几乎所有的技术都是围绕对象展开。本文将要讲述的Monitor并不是Java对象,而是在操作系统中关联的“对象”,Monitor是Java重量级锁synchronized实现的关键,因此学习Java单机同步机制就离不开对Monitor的剖析。Monitor从Java层面经常被人们称为监视器锁,而在操作系统层面称为管程。
图解栈帧,别死记硬背
如何查看Java进程和线程